McGarvie takes NJCAA National honor
FLINT - Kiera McGarvie has been named the NJCAA National DII Softball Player of the Week for the Bears after an outstanding week, helping Mott Community College clinch the MCCAA Eastern Conference title.
McGarvie was 11-for-15 for a .733 batting average. She had two home runs, two doubles, seven RBIs, and six stolen bases. The national award is the first for Mott this season. McGarvie was also named the MCCAA Eastern Conference Player of the Week for the fourth time this season.
In addition, Maggie Boehm earned MCCAA Eastern Conference Pitcher of the Week honors. She was 3-0 with three complete games and a shutout. Boehm tossed 21 innings, allowing two runs and striking out 23.
The Bears are 34-7 overall and 25-1 in the MCCAA. Mott returns to action against Oakland Community College at 3 pm on Friday in Flint.
